I really like the new bass levels and the darker piano tones. The bass part really works to frame the song nicely.
 
I'm imagining a woodier sounding, darker (less *effecty* sounding) snare that will work its way back just by the change in predominant frequency.
 
Imagine replacing the guitar solo with a baritone sax or maybe a french horn and ask your self if the song really jives with a late 80's guitar tone or if that just happened as a matter of course or habit.
 
How about pushing the upper midrange on the vocals, and maybe lo-shelf the vocal as well... maybe a few dB down up to 200Hz+ with a mild Q. I assume you have a low cut on it... even if you don't use the shelf use a low cut to dig out some of the bass. It sounds like you have a lot of proximity effect from singing real close to the mic.
 
If I were mixing I'd run a copy of the vocal through Melodyne just to see if I liked the results.
 
The back ground vocals sound real nice. Maybe a touch of low cut on them... I'd wait till after working the lead vocal a bit.
 
I like this song a lot otherwise I wouldn't list stuff the way I have. You have a great song on your hands.
